Financial Analyst

Work Location: 6080 Young Street, Halifax, NS (On-site, 5 days per week) Department: Finance & Corporate Services Reports To: Accounting Manager
Employment Status: Full time, 40 hours per week

In this role, you will be part of a team primarily focused on balance sheet accounts and various supporting corporate services. Financial Analysts are responsible for providing financial and administrative support for projects, month-end activities and financial reporting.

Key Responsibilities

Capital Project Analysis and Maintenance

Capital Expenditures Analysis

Journal Entry Preparation

GL Reconciliations

Differentiating Between Capital and Current Expenses

Monthly Accruals

Receiving Purchase Orders

Billing Requests

Ad Hoc Requests

Qualifications:

Completion of post-secondary education with a focus in accounting

Current enrollment or desire to enroll in a professional accounting designation is considered an asset

One to three years of relevant experience

Ability to prioritize and consistently meet deadlines

Desire to work in a positive and dynamic team environment

Strong organizational skills and attention to detail

Ability to multi-task and adapt to continuous change

Have strong analytical and critical-thinking skills

Ability to communicate effectively and build working relationships across departments

Proficiency in Microsoft Excel and other Microsoft Office applications
